FAQs
Q: Are white bumps always a sign of STDs?
No. Many are harmless (like Fordyce spots or ingrown hairs). But some STDs can cause similar bumps, so it’s worth getting checked if you’re unsure.
Q: Can I pop or squeeze them?
No, especially not cysts or ingrown hairs. This can lead to infection or scarring.
Q: How are they treated?
Treatment depends on the cause. Harmless bumps need no treatment, while infections may require antibiotics, antivirals, or minor procedures.
